Which is better, Polo GT TSI or TDI?
While both engines are powerful, once on the move, it’s the better refinement of the TSI engine that you tend to gravitate towards. The TDI engine is quite raw and has lots of grunt, and though it does rev cleanly to and past it’s redline, it is accompanied with a lot of vibration and cabin noise. The GT TSI has a lot of tech – direct-injection, turbo-charging, ESP and a twin-clutch automatic – while the GT TDI has the more conventional approach of common-rail diesel engine and a manual gearbox. What is the specs of the 1. GT TSI?
The New Polo GT TSI is equipped with 1. Litre, 4 cylinder TSI engine with a maximum power output of 77 Kw @ 5000rpm and a maximum torque of 175 Nm @1500-4100 rpm with a 7 Speed DSG Gear Box.
